Ingredients
DIBUTYL PHTHALATE, DI-N-BUTYL PHTHALATE
CAS: 84-74-2
RTECS: TI0875000
Fraction By Weight: 1-5%
OSHA PEL 5 MG/CUM
ACGIH TLV: 5 MG/CUM
EPA Report Quantity: 10 LBS
DOT Report Quantity: 10 LBS
BUTYL ACETATE (N-BUTYL ACETATE)
CAS: 123-86-4
RTECS: AF7350000
Fraction By Weight: 37%
OSHA PEL 710 MG/CUM
ACGIH TLV: 713 MG/CUM
EPA Report Quantity: 5000 LBS
DOT Report Quantity: 5000 LBS
ACETONE; DIMETHYL KETONE; 2-PROPANONE
CAS: 67-64-1
RTECS: AL3150000
Fraction By Weight: 51%
OSHA PEL 2400 MG/CUM
ACGIH TLV: 750 PPM
EPA Report Quantity: 5000 LBS
DOT Report Quantity: 5000 LBS
ISOPROPANOL (ISOPROPYL ALCOHOL), 2-PROPANOL, DIMETHYL
CAS: 67-63-0
RTECS: NT8050000
Fraction By Weight: 10%
OSHA PEL 400 PPM
ACGIH TLV: 400 PPM
Hazards
Routes of Entry: Inhalation:NO Skin:NO Ingestion:NO
Reports of Carcinogenicity:NTP:NO IARC:NO OSHA:NO
Health Hazards Acute and Chronic:EYES: IRRITATION. SKIN: DERMATITIS.
Explanation of Carcinogenicity:NONE
Effects of Overexposure:IRRITATION, DEFATTING, HEADACHE, NAUSEA,
VOMITING
First Aid
First Aid:EYES: FLUSH W/WATER FOR 15 MINUTES. SKIN: FLUSH AFFECTED AREA
W/WATER. WASH W/MILD SOAP & WATER. INHALATION: REMOVE TO FRESH AIR.
INDUCE VOMITING. OBTAIN MEDICAL ATTENTION IN ALL CASES.
Fire Fighting
Flash Point Method:TCC
Flash Point:15F
Extinguishing Media:SMALL: CO2, DRY CHEMICAL; LARGE: ALCOHOL TYPE FOAM
Fire Fighting Procedures:DILUTE W/PLENTY OF WATER.
Accidental Release
Spill Release Procedures:REMOVE IGNITION SOURCES. FLUSH W/WATER.
COLLECT LARGE AMOUNTS FOR DISPOSAL/INCINERATION.
Handling
Handling and Storage Precautions:KEEP CONTAINER CLOSED. KEEP AWAY FROM
HEAT, SPARKS, FLAMES.
Exposure Controls
Respiratory Protection:ALL PURPOSE CANISTER MASK IN CASES OF HIGH
CONCENTRATION.
Ventilation:LOCAL EHXAUST
Protective Gloves:BUTYL
Eye Protection:GOGGLES
Supplemental Safety and Health
Chemical Properties
Boiling Pt:B.P. Text:133-644F
Vapor Pres:100
Vapor Density:2.76
Spec Gravity:0.835
Evaporation Rate & Reference:(BU AC =1): 1.51
Solubility in Water:APPRECIABLE
Appearance and Odor:WATER WHITE W/FRUITY, LEMON ODOR
Percent Volatiles by Volume:100
Stability
Stability Indicator/Materials to Avoid:YES
STRONG OXIDIZERS
Stability Condition to Avoid:HEAT, SPARKS, FLAME
Hazardous Decomposition Products:CO, CO2
Disposal
Waste Disposal Methods:ATOMIZE INTO AN INCINERATOR. DISPOSE OF
IAW/FEDERL, STATE & LOCAL REGULATIONS.
